Data processing |
Raw sequencing data were filtered using standard RNA-seq parameters (Illumina pipeline). The transcriptome short reads (< 25 bp) were filtered out using DynamicTrim and LengthSort of solexaQA package The read counts were calculated by mapping the filtered reads that passed the pre-processing using HTSeq The filtered reads were normalised using the DESeq library The IR ratio was calculated by dividing the read depth of introns by the average read depth of two adjacent exons The intron retention (IR) ratio was calculated by dividing the read depth of introns by the average read depth of two adjacent exons. AS occurred outside of IRs requiring junction reads, junction information was extracted using regtools Genome_build: IRGSP-1.0 (Oryza sativa Japonica Group (Japanese rice) genome assembly) Supplementary_files_format_and_content: Xlsx was processed data
